In a thermocouple, the temperature that does not depend on the temperature of the cold junction is called
Text Solution
Verified by ExpertsThe correct answer is:
A
Step 1: Understand thermocouples. A thermocouple consists of two different metals joined at one end, which produces a voltage as a result of a temperature difference between the junctions.
Step 2: The cold junction is at a known temperature, while the hot junction's temperature is what the thermocouple measures.
Step 3: The term 'neutral temperature' refers to the temperature at which the thermoelectric properties of the two metals balance out, resulting in no voltage change regardless of the cold junction's temperature.
Step 4: In contrast, the 'temperature of inversion' does relate to changes in the cold junction's temperature influencing the output voltage, so it is not independent.
Conclusion: Therefore, the correct answer is Option A, Neutral temperature.
